Remove deprecated FileRef::create() method

In order to achieve this, the TagLib_File type of the C bindings is now
a FileRef and no longer a File. The support for the .oga extension has been
ported to FileRef(), so that taglib_file_new() should still behave the
same, but additionally also support content based file type detection.
